宝塔面板是强大的服务器管理工具,提供便捷的服务器管理,其中集成的Kafka消息系统对于处理高并发消息流非常高效,本指南将详细介绍如何在宝塔面板上安装和配置Kafka,包括环境准备、安装步骤、配置设置及常见问题排查,确保您能快速掌握Kafka在宝塔面板的部署,为高负载消息处理提供坚实基础。
随着大数据时代的到来,消息队列系统在数据处理和系统解耦中扮演着越来越重要的角色,Apache Kafka以其高吞吐量、低延迟和高可靠性,成为了众多企业和开发者首选的消息中间件,本文将详细介绍如何在宝塔面板上安装和配置Kafka消息系统,帮助读者快速上手并实现高效的消息处理。
前言
宝塔面板是一款简洁易用的服务器管理面板,集成了Linux操作系统、Nginx反向代理、MySQL数据库等多种常用功能,为用户提供了一个一站式的管理平台,而Kafka则以其高吞吐量和低延迟的特性,广泛应用于实时数据处理、日志收集等领域,本文将详细介绍如何在宝塔面板上安装和配置Kafka消息系统。
环境准备
在开始安装Kafka之前,需要确保服务器满足以下要求:
-
确保已安装Java环境,因为Kafka基于Java开发。
-
确保服务器拥有足够的存储空间和网络带宽,以支持大数据处理。
安装宝塔面板
需要登录到服务器,并下载宝塔面板并进行安装,安装过程中,需要设置管理员账户、密码以及一些基本的配置选项。
安装Nginx
宝塔面板默认集成了Nginx反向代理服务器,因此需要确保Nginx已经正确安装并运行,可以通过运行以下命令来检查Nginx状态:
sudo systemctl status nginx
如果Nginx未运行,则可以使用以下命令启动它:
sudo systemctl start nginx
安装Kafka
在宝塔面板中,可以通过面板自带的软件包管理器来安装Kafka,在面板管理页面中,找到“软件包管理”选项,并搜索“kafka”,选择一个合适的版本进行安装,按照提示完成安装过程。
配置Kafka
安装完成后,需要对Kafka进行配置,在宝塔面板的“控制台”中,找到“Kafka”选项,进入Kafka的配置页面,可以修改Kafka的名称、BrokerID、数据目录等参数,以满足实际需求。
还需要配置Kafka的Zookeeper连接参数,以确保Kafka集群之间的通信正常。
启动与验证
完成配置后,可以启动Kafka服务,在宝塔面板的“控制台”中,找到“Kafka”选项,点击“启动”按钮,等待一段时间,让Kafka完成初始化过程。
启动完成后,可以通过Kafka客户端工具或宝塔面板的监控页面来验证Kafka是否正常工作,可以创建一个主题,并发送和接收消息,以确认Kafka的性能和稳定性。
本文详细介绍了在宝塔面板上安装和配置Kafka消息系统的过程,通过本文的学习,读者可以轻松地在宝塔面板上部署和管理Kafka消息系统,实现高效的消息处理和系统解耦,希望本文对读者有所帮助!